For heads of department: the proposed joint venture with Aldentree Systems would combine our Ferris analytics platform with their distribution network in the Caldora market. Capital commitment is split sixty-forty, with governance shared equally. Our modelling shows breakeven in year two under conservative assumptions, though currency exposure remains a concern. Department-level impacts are summarised in the appendix. The confidential strategic rationale is set out directly below.

board note of baweg-bawig: Project Tamath slips by six weeks because of the audit delay.

UserSplit Cutover Drift: the extracted account service and the legacy Marigold monolith user module are reporting divergent record counts during dual-write. This fires when drift exceeds 0.5% over 15 minutes. New team members should not replay writes manually. Reconciliation steps and the rollback procedure are documented on the internal page.

wiki page, tajog-fafog: https://gitlab.paliqsys.corp/dash/display/job/853dd6fcbf54

**Q: How do we load test the Cartwheel checkout flow before merging?**

Run the Stampede harness against the staging stack only. Target 500 virtual shoppers, ramp over five minutes, and hold for fifteen. Watch p99 latency on the payment-intent endpoint; anything over 900ms fails the gate. Don't point Stampede at the shared QA environment — it shares a database with the Ledgerline team and they will notice. Results land in the perf dashboard automatically. The full harness config and threshold table live on the internal page below.

runbook for badug-kadup: https://confluence.zemvarlabs.internal/projects/browse/display/projects/bd1b

**Break-glass access — Fernhollow greenhouse controller**

Plugin authors: if sensor drift compensation in the Fernhollow core locks out your plugin's calibration writes, do not attempt repeated retries, as the controller will quarantine your plugin ID. Instead, use the break-glass path: request a maintenance window, put the controller into safe mode, and open the local recovery terminal on the unit itself. The terminal authenticates with a single passphrase, reproduced below for authorized maintainers.

vault phrase of faduf-hagug = frair-eliath-briion-quenix-kasael